ZIP 55372 is significantly wealthier than the US average, with a median household income of $145,499. Population has held roughly steady since 2024. 50%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, well above the national rate of 36%. Median home value is $467,400. Poverty is rare here, at 2.7% of residents. Among the 7 ZIP codes in Scott County, 55372 ranks 2nd by median household income.
